## 3.8.0 — Changed defaults (Lanternpath deep-link routing)

Default fallback behavior changed: unresolved deep links now route to the in-app search screen instead of the home tab. Link-expiry default shortened. Support: users complaining about "links opening search" are seeing intended behavior, not a bug. Old defaults can be restored per tenant. New default configuration follows.

deployment values, kajep-kageg:
[praix]
host = praix.paliqcorp.corp
user = praix_svc
database = praix_prod

Quarterly Planning Note — Revised Commission Scheme

Finance team: from next quarter, the sales-commission scheme for the Driftvale portfolio changes to a tiered structure with accelerators above 110% of target. Clawback applies to cancellations within 90 days. Please update accrual models, adjust the payout calendar to monthly, and reconcile legacy entitlements under the old scheme by period close. Torsten will own the transition ledger. The confidential note on related business plans appears below.

management briefing: Project Ulavan slips by two quarters because of the staffing delay.

**Key ceremony checklist — item 7 (Queue cutover, Team Sallowfen)**

Before retiring the homegrown job queue and switching to Conveyor, confirm that both the old and new brokers hold a copy of the signing key. New team members: this step exists because the old queue encrypts its dead-letter archive, and we must be able to drain it after cutover. When the ceremony lead asks, the designated keyholder reads aloud the recovery passphrase, which is:

vault phrase of kafog-kahif = holdor-rusir-praox

**Build provenance — Fernquery N+1 fix.** Quick note for newcomers: the batching dataloader that killed our GraphQL N+1 problem shipped in the Marlet release train, not mainline, so don't go hunting for it in old mainline tags. Provenance attestations live alongside each artifact in the Coppice registry. To verify you're running the fixed build, check for the token below.

pipeline stamp: htk21_86b657ac0aa916a9af17f